4,294,990,012 is a composite number, even.
4,294,990,012 (four billion two hundred ninety-four million nine hundred ninety thousand twelve) is an even 10-digit number. It is a composite number with 12 divisors, and factors as 2² × 15,161 × 70,823. Written other ways, in hexadecimal, 0x1000058BC.
